I stopped rehearsing answers to "tell me about yourself" and started doing something way simpler that actually got me more callbacks by amberridgetally in jobsearchhacks

[–]OpTeaMist22 0 points1 point  (0 children)

Two interviews is my max. I usually do the first over zoom and it takes 15 mins max. I usually do 10 interviews to find two decent candidates. I also like to think about my initial reaction. I like to meet people twice. If they make it to the second interview they will meet the rest of the team and whoever their manager will be to see how they get on with them. I’m not going to call respective managers into every interview I have. It’s a waste of their time. That will prob be 30 mins absolute maximum.

So 45 mins overall and the first one being a zoom option.

I stopped rehearsing answers to "tell me about yourself" and started doing something way simpler that actually got me more callbacks by amberridgetally in jobsearchhacks

[–]OpTeaMist22 2 points3 points  (0 children)

I always ask people to tell me about themselves as my first question.

If you talk about work my brain will wonder. I don’t care about your work at this point. I can read that on the resume. What I want to know is can I be around you for 40 hours a week. Will you fit in with the team. Can you have a normal conversation. I just want to chat to the person.

If you pass interview one. I’ll schedule interview two which is more technical in approach and will ask work related questions.
